There's some good....and a lot of bad
Team Member Star (Former Employee) - New York, NY - July 18, 2022
Alright so I didn't spend a lot of time at this company. I'll start off with the plus side. You get to move up quickly. The base pay is a little higher than minimum. You're basically going to be working with the same people and get to know your team, which can be a plus or a downside depending on the people you work with. You do get to have a free meal and free coffee as well. Now the downsides. Some of these do depend on the management people you get stuck with so it's mostly based on personal experience. Upper management is seriously stupid. I was expected to do my new role perfectly while having my hours cut, which took away prep time, despite not having the role title officially and only being with the company for about a month or 2. Training is done through a screen. I was told to do modules that could only be done during work but I was still expected to do my regular duties on top of that. I got minimal training and help from other people. I got trained a bit by the former hot chef who was very eager to leave. While it's not hard it is very fast pace especially working in the morning so being new and having no support makes for a stressful time. A lot of the maintenance of the store was not kept up. This is a store specific problem though. You aren't allowed to take tips. This is a huge fault because given how busy the morning was you could easily make 5+ additional dollars an hour at no cost to the company which would make the work load a bit more worth it.
